The Interreg Baltic Sea Region 2021-2027 Programme (see/ download summary) offers “funding to public and private players around the Baltic Sea who want to shape the region with their smart ideas”. The programme has four Priorities: (1) Innovative societies, (2) Water-smart societies, (3) Climate-neutral societies, and (4) Cooperation governance.

Small steps for a big change.
Small projects focus: easier access, building trust, keeping networks, staying closer to citizens, responding to unpredictable challenges (duration – up to 24 months, with up to 500 KEuros budget).

Timeline in 2022:
8 Feb – official launch of the Call
9 Mar – deadline for submitting Project Idea Forms
16 Mar – deadline for consultations & deadline for requesting access to BAMOS+
30 Mar – deadline for submitting applications

Summer/Autumn – selection of applications by the Monitoring Committee.

Core changes for the Interreg Baltic Sea Region.
Core projects focus: practical and durable outputs, solutions to challenges, focus on piloting, at the core of the Programme (duration – up to 36 months, with no limitation (proportionate to activities) for budget).

Timeline in 2022:
8 Feb – official launch of the Call
15 Mar – deadline for submitting Project Idea Forms
12 Apr – deadline for consultations & deadline for requesting access to BAMOS+
26 Apr – deadline for submitting applications

Autumn – selection of applications by the Monitoring Committee.
